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our technician will arrive at your property, assess the situation, and identify the source of the leak. We’ll create a customized plan to restore your property to its original condition, taking into account the severity of the leak, the size of the affected area, and any local conditions that may impact the process. Our technician will explain the plan to you, answer any questions you may have, and provide a detailed estimate of the work to be done.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Our team will use the latest equipment to extract the water from your property, including wet vacuums, pumps, and extraction tools. We’ll work quickly and efficiently to remove as much water as possible, reducing the risk of further damage and reducing the risk of mold and mildew growth.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water has been extracted, our team will use specialized equipment to dry the area and remove any remaining moisture. We’ll use dehumidifiers and air movers to speed up the drying process, ensuring your property is restored to its original condition as quickly as possible.
Step 4: Cleaning and Disinfection
Our team will thoroughly clean and disinfect the affected area, removing any dirt, grime, or bacteria that may have accumulated. We’ll use specialized cleaning solutions and equipment to ensure your property is restored to its original condition.
Step 5: Restoration and Reconstruction
Once the affected area has been cleaned and disinfected, our team will work with you to restore your property to its original condition. This may involve reconstruction, repairs, or replacement of damaged materials. We’ll work closely with you to ensure you’re informed and comfortable throughout the process.

Toilet Overflow Water Removal Cost in Manvel, TX
The cost of toilet overflow water removal in Manvel, TX, varies based on the severity of the leak,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our estimates range from $500 to $2,500 or more, depending on the complexity of the job. The cost of equipment, labor, and materials will be included in your estimate, and we’ll work with you to create a plan that fits your budget.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and removal | $500 – $1,500 | The severity of the leak and the size of the affected area impact the cost of water extraction and removal. |
| Drying and dehumidification | $500 – $1,000 | The size of the affected area and the complexity of the drying process impact the cost of drying and dehumidification. |
| Cleaning and disinfection | $200 – $500 | The size of the affected area and the level of contamination impact the cost of cleaning and disinfection. |
| Restoration and reconstruction | $1,000 – $3,000 | The severity of the damage and the complexity of the restoration process impact the cost of restoration and reconstruction. |
| Equipment rental and transportation | $100 – $300 | The type and quantity of equipment required impact the cost of equipment rental and transportation. |
| Travel and labor costs | $200 – $500 | The distance to your property and the complexity of the job impact the cost of travel and labor. |
